Kennagri Farms: A Technological Transformation in Dairy Farming
Kennagri Farms is a forward-thinking agricultural enterprise situated in Forge Creek, Victoria. Under the ownership of the Kennedy family since 2024, the farm has undergone a remarkable transformation from a traditional sheep, beef, and cropping enterprise to a cutting-edge robotic dairy system.

Transition to Robotic Dairy System
In a significant strategic shift, Kennagri Farms has embraced advanced technology in its operations. The farm now utilizes automated milking technology, which is at the forefront of modern dairy practices. This transition marks a departure from its previous focus on beef cattle breeding, sheep, and cropping, reflecting a commitment to innovation and efficiency.
High-Tech Milk Production
The adoption of intensive fodder management techniques complements the automated milking system, ensuring that milk production is both high-tech and sustainable. This approach not only enhances productivity but also supports the farm's long-term viability in the competitive dairy market.
Significant Events
The purchase of the 146-hectare property by the Kennedy family in 2024 was a pivotal moment for Kennagri Farms. This acquisition enabled the strategic shift towards dairy, setting the stage for the integration of robotic systems and advanced agricultural practices.
